An indexed universal life insurance coverage plan consists of a fatality benefit, in addition to a part that is tied to a stock exchange index. The money value growth depends upon the efficiency of that index. These policies offer greater possible returns than various other kinds of life insurance coverage, along with higher threats and extra costs.
A 401(k) has even more investment choices to pick from and may include an employer match. On the other hand, an IUL features a survivor benefit and an additional cash worth that the policyholder can borrow versus. Nevertheless, they also feature high premiums and fees, and unlike a 401(k), they can be terminated if the insured quits paying right into them.

If you're browsing for lifetime insurance coverage, indexed universal life insurance policy is one option you might desire to think about. Like other long-term life insurance items, these plans enable you to build cash value you can tap during your life time.
That implies you have more lasting development capacity than an entire life plan, which provides a fixed price of return. Typically, IUL policies avoid you from experiencing losses in years when the index sheds value.
Comprehend the benefits and drawbacks of this product to establish whether it lines up with your economic goals. As long as you pay the premiums, the policy remains effective for your entire life. You can gather cash value you can use throughout your lifetime for various monetary needs. You can adjust your costs and death benefit if your scenarios transform.
Irreversible life insurance policy plans usually have greater first costs than term insurance policy, so it may not be the appropriate choice if you get on a limited budget plan. To understand IUL, we first require to damage it down right into its core components: the money value part the death benefit and the cash money value. The survivor benefit is the quantity of cash paid out to the insurance holder's beneficiaries upon their death. The plan's cash-in value, on the various other hand, is an investment part that expands gradually.
